MAINTENANCE : AIR CONDITIONING CIRCUIT EFFECTIVENESS

ESSENTIAL : Any personnel working on an electric or rechargeable hybrid vehicle must have received electric vehicle-specific training
and be authorised to work on these vehicles (please observe the regulations that are in force in the country concerned).

1. Workshop equipment
Equipment necessary for the check :
Air conditioning circuit filling and recycling station
Thermometer
Hygrometer
Diagbox (Automatic procedure) or Service Box (Manual procedure)

2. Method of checking
2.1. Preliminary checks
Make the following checks :
Operation of the aircon compressor clutch (according to equipment)
Condition of the air conditioning compressor belt
General condition of the air conditioning pipes
Condition of the front face of the vehicle (fan assembly, condenser, etc.)
Check of the pollen filter

2.2. Dynamic pressures check


Place the vehicle in a protected area (out of wind, sun, etc.).
Vehicle configuration :
Connect a charging and recycling station to the air conditioning circuit
Doors and windows closed
Bonnet closed
Engine running and warm
Engine speed at idle
Wait for the fan to switch on at the first speed (Air conditioning not operating)

Position of the air conditioning controls (In the case of automatic air conditioning) :
Set the temperature to all cold mode
Activate the windscreen demisting mode (visibility mode)
Close all the air vents

For your information, the "windscreen deicing mode (visibility mode)" requires the following conditions to be met :
Air conditioning in the on position
Air blower on the maximum position
Air distribution in deicing position
Air inlet in the exterior air position

Position of the air conditioning controls (In the case of manual air conditioning) :
Set the temperature to all cold mode
Move the air distribution control to the deicing position
Place the air blower control on maximum
Activate the air conditioning function (Indicator lamp lit)
Place the air intake in the exterior air position
Close all the air vents

Measure the ambient humidity and temperature of the workshop.

CAUTION : Position the thermometer at the windscreen demisting vent.

Note the following values after the air conditioning has been operating for 3 minutes :

Air temperature at the outlet of the windscreen demisting vents
Air conditioning circuit high pressure
Air conditioning circuit low pressure

3. Interpretation of the values


3.1. Automatic procedure (Vehicles listed in Diagbox)
Refer to the tool Diagbox in the Maintenance menu.
The tool Diagbox evaluates the efficiency of the cold loop with reference to the conformity graphs.
3.2. Manual procedure (Vehicles not listed in DiagBox)

N.B. : Remove and visually check the pollen filter before suggesting replacement of the pollen filter to the customer.

N.B. : If the customer complains of an unpleasant odour in his air conditioning, carry out an olfactory test of the air conditioning and
suggest antibacterial treatment of the air conditioning to the customer.

Print the assessment available at the following (URL) address depending on language.
Follow the efficiency test procedure.

3.3. Using the graph

Figure : C5HD00UD

"T1" : Deicing vent temperature (in °C).


"T2" : Workshop ambient temperature (in °C).
"P" : Pressure in the air conditioning circuit (in bars).
"A" : Air conditioning circuit high pressure reference zone.
"B" : Reference graph for deicing vent temperature (± 5°C) depending on the workshop ambient humidity (from 30 to 100%).
"C" : Air conditioning circuit low pressure reference zone.
Operations to be done on the print-out :
Find the workshop temperature on the graph : This temperature is to be found on the horizontal axis (T2)
Relate the low pressure to the ambient temperature with reference to the right-hand scale (P)
Relate the high pressure to the ambient temperature with reference to the right-hand scale (P)
Relate the measured air vent temperature to the ambient temperature with reference to the left-hand scale (T1)
Check the position of each value in relation to the corresponding graph and note their position: below, conforming to or above the
reference

4. Using the formula matrix and interpreting the results

CAUTION : The formula matrix is an employee’s work tool and must not be given to the customer.

N.B. : The formula matrix contains confidential PSA information.

In accordance with the 3 measurements taken (low pressure, high pressure and vent temperature), determine the effectiveness of the air
conditioning from among the 27 cases presented in the formula matrix (Tick, on the air conditioning assessment, in the sections "effectivenes
of the air conditioning" and "recommendations").

4.4. Table of interpretation of results

Case Low pressure High pressure Vent temperature Result of the check (*) recommendations
n° measured measured measured (**)
1 <C <A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
2 <C <A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
3 <C <A >B Maintenance 1-4
recommendation
4 <C =A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
5 <C =A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
6 <C =A >B Maintenance 1-4
recommendation
7 <C >A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
8 <C >A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
9 <C >A >B Repair recommendation 3
10 =C <A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
11 =C <A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
12 =C <A >B Maintenance 1-4
recommendation
13 =C =A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
14 =C =A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
15 =C =A >B Maintenance 1-4
recommendation
16 =C >A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
17 =C >A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
18 =C >A >B Repair recommendation 3
19 >C <A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
20 >C <A =B Maintenance 1-4
recommendation
21 >C <A >B Repair recommendation 3
22 >C =A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
23 >C =A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
24 >C =A >B Repair recommendation 3
25 >C >A <B Air conditioning operating 2-4
26 >C >A =B Air conditioning operating 2-4
27 >C >A >B Repair recommendation 3

N.B. : (*) Option to be ticked on the assessment (Effectiveness of the air conditioning section).

N.B. : (**) Option to be ticked on the assessment (Recommendations section).

Options to be ticked
1 Recharging the air conditioning circuit
2 No recharging of the air conditioning circuit
3 Complete diagnostics required
4 No complete diagnostics required

5. Result to be achieved
Finish filling in the air conditioning assessment in paper format and give it to the customer.
